Output 6b8a75034d24084f71df84493998f373a90f22dd8082db31677d953b0ad1ac9c:0

value
2629212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8918f20b6daca7be9b7c4ea7d1d3059665e72723 OP_EQUAL
address
3EBvP4rmg6Sw6zphVhdEYJsZ8WUTcKfDa7
transaction
6b8a75034d24084f71df84493998f373a90f22dd8082db31677d953b0ad1ac9c
spent
true